In the US state of Montana, announced an emergency because of floods

Because of the floods, Governor of the US state of Montana, Steve Bullock on Wednesday declared a state of emergency in seven counties and the Indian reservation of Fort Belknap.
The appropriate solution will allow using equipment and materials to protect critical infrastructure from flooding.
Under the water after a snowy winter and the rapid melting of snow were the northern regions of Montana. The floods can damage houses, farms and infrastructure.
A number of roads were flooded. The authorities called on local residents to be ready for urgent evacuation.
